UCLA’s Veteran Core Has Led The Way To A Solid Start

Jaylen Clark led the Bruins in points with 19 and rebounds with nine in the team’s 86-56 blowout win at home over the Norfolk State Spartans on Monday night. Clark is leading the Bruins in scoring through their first three games with 17.3 points per game and is one of four upperclassmen who returned this season after finishing last year among the team’s top seven scorers. Last year’s squad advanced to the Sweet 16 and finished with a 27-8 SU record.

UCLA’s defense has allowed only 58.3 points per game through the team’s first three games, though those all came against weak visiting teams that the Bruins were heavily favored against. This matchup against a top-25 offense will be a good early litmus test for the UCLA defense.

Terrence Shannon Jr. Looks Like A Breakout Star In Illinois

Terrence Shannon Jr. went 9-for-14 from the floor and racked up 30 points in just 23 minutes on Monday night in Illinois’ 103-65 win at home over the Monmouth Hawks. Shannon averaged 11 points per game in three seasons playing for the defensive-minded Texas Tech Red Raiders, but with more freedom on offense in Illinois, he is off to a great start, averaging 22.7 points through his first three games.

Sophomore Dain Dainja is also off to a hot start, averaging 17.3 points, and as a team the Illini rank 19th in the nation in scoring at 92 points per game. Illinois has gone 2-0 ATS over its last two games since going 0-6 ATS over its previous six. Like UCLA, Illinois will get a real test Friday after being favored by over 25 points in its first three games.
